    W4 question
    I had some questions regarding filling W4 forms for my wife and me. I tried filling the forms using the instructions, but want to be sure I am doing it correctly.

    I have been working since Jan 2012, however my wife was not working, hence I claimed 3 exemptions in Line H of W4. My wife started working in November 2012. So for this new situation, how many exemptions can I claim and how many can my wife claim in each of our W4 forms?

    I would greatly appreciate if someone could guide me.

    AtlantaTaxExpert
    Claiming 3 exemptions is fine if you are married and you plan to file jointly for 2012.

    If you are both working in 2013, however, you will both need to submit new Forms W-4 claiming married status. The obne with the higher salary claims ONE exemption while the lower salary claims ZERO exemptions.

    This is necessary because the first dollar of her salary is probably taxed at 15%, requiring you both over-withhold to compensate.
